Historical
Example: We visited a historical museum last weekend.
Definition
"Historical" describes something related to history or past events, often referring to things, places, or periods that have significance or importance in understanding human history. For example, a "historical" museum showcases artifacts and stories from earlier times.
Etymology
The word "historical" comes from the Late Latin 'historicus,' which derived from the Greek 'historikos,' meaning 'pertaining to history or inquiry.' It entered English in the late 16th century, initially used in scholarly contexts. Did you know? The root 'historia' in Greek means 'a learning or knowing by inquiry,' highlighting the investigative nature of history.
